Israeli occupation forces on Tuesday pushed deep into an area east of Khan Younis, in the southern Gaza Strip, as well as the town of Jabalya in northern Gaza. Palestinian sources said that Israeli forces, backed with bulldozers and tanks, moved hundreds of meters into the two areas and razed farmlands. Meanwhile, the so-called “Israel Land Administration” on Tuesday started to plough lands owned by Arabs south of Bersheba under the protection of Israeli police. According to media sources, Israel claims there is a dispute over land ownership, adding that more than 3000 dunums were plowed last week in various parts of the Negev desert
